图书馆提供信息化及智能化的信息咨询、推荐与提供服务是高校建设智慧化校园的重要组成部分.本文在充分分析高校数据孤立、业务流程低效、交互性差等实际问题的基础上,给出基于云计算和大数据等技术来构建统一、规范的图书个性化推荐与服务的统一平台. 将该系统划分为数据存储层、业务处理层和界面表示与交互层,并设计了每个层次上的系统功能. 进一步地,以业务处理层中的图书资料推荐算法为重点,设计了一种基于主题模型和关联规则挖掘的混合型推荐算法. 通过实验证实,该方法能比基于文本相似性的传统方法获得更高的推荐准确性.

Libraries provide intelligent information advices and recommendations, which is an important part for the construction of wisdom campus. The current situation of campus construction is mainly reflected by the fol-lowing features: isolated data, low efficiency of business process and poor interaction, etc. Based on the deep anal-ysis, the paper proposes to build a unified and standardized platform for book service and personalized recommen-dation based on cloud computing and big data techniques. The whole platform is divided into three levels: data storage layer, business process layer and the interface representation and interaction layer. At the same time, the function in each layer is also designed. Furthermore, for the business of books and documents recommendation, the paper presents a hybrid algorithm by combining topic model and associate rule. Finally, the experiments con-firm that our method can achieve higher accuracy than conventional text similarity-based recommendation method.
